Aviatrix Controllers OS Command Injection Vulnerability
Aviatrix — Controller
An issue was discovered in Aviatrix Controller before 7.1.4191 and 7.2.x before 7.2.4996. Due to the improper neutralization of special elements used in an OS command, an unauthenticated attacker is able to execute arbitrary code. Shell metacharacters can be sent to /v1/api in cloud_type for list_flightpath_destination_instances, or src_cloud_type for flightpath_connection_test.

How severe is CVE-2024-50603?
CVE-2024-50603 has a CVSS base score of 10.0 out of 10 (CVSS 3.1).
Is CVE-2024-50603 actively exploited in the wild?
Yes. CVE-2024-50603 is listed in the CISA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og, added Jan 16, 2025, meaning CISA has confirmed evidence of active exploitation.
What is the EPSS score for CVE-2024-50603?
98.5% - meaning FIRST.org's EPSS model estimates a 98.5% probability this vulnerability will be exploited in the wild within 30 days (100% percentile among all scored CVEs).
Is there exploit tooling available for CVE-2024-50603?
Yes - a public Nuclei template referencing CVE-2024-50603 exist in public repositories we checked.
What type of vulnerability is CVE-2024-50603?
CVE-2024-50603 is classified under CWE-78 (CWE-78 Improper Neutralization of Special Elements used in an OS Command ('OS Command Injection')).
